Psychological accidents — People naturally concentrate on the physical injuries of a crash, however a traumatic occasion could cause mental well being issues, too. The psychological trauma can have an effect on both the driver and passengers. Issues can include posttraumatic stress disorder, nervousness and despair. Stabilization and sensorimotor exercise approaches are designed to appropriate defective movement patterns in routine activities and everyday life. Such whiplash treatment trains the nervous system to better coordinate and control movement patterns, and improves the ability of the neck muscle tissue to maintain stability of the neck. Soon after, the chiropractor’s whiplash remedy must be shifted toward restoration of the affected person’s function. This means helping the affected person return to work, home and recreational activities as quickly as attainable after sustaining the whiplash injuries. This course of could involve a gradual transition to these actions, even when the affected person just isn't sure that he or she can have interaction in them fully.

No differences have been famous between people who had received debriefing and those who did not with respect to PTSD-associated morbidity. Similar results were reported by Hobbs, Mayou, Harrison, and Worlock (1996), who worked with extra significantly injured MVA survivors. In this trial, the 1-hour debriefing was administered 24 to 48 hours after the MVA in the hospital and once more, did not seem to have helped participants. A three-12 months comply with-up with people who were involved within the Hobbs et al. (1996) study indicated that individuals who had obtained debriefing had a significantly worse consequence (e.g., extra self-reported psychiatric symptoms, higher nervousness about auto journey, larger pain, decrease total levels of functioning, and extra financial problems, Mayou, Ehlers, & Hobbs, 2000). These studies, together, recommend that single session debriefing is not suggested in the immediate aftermath of a severe MVA.

In addition to CBT, common supportive psychotherapy has been shown to be somewhat effective for MVA-related PTSD. Two treatment research have included supportive psychotherapy as a comparison situation for CBT (Blanchard et al., 2003; R. A. Bryant, Moulds, Guthrie, Dang, & Nixon, 2003).
